Why These Are the Top Roofing Contractors in Masonville

Masonville, Colorado, is an unincorporated community in Larimer County situated at a high elevation near the foothills of the Rocky Mountains. The roofing market is heavily influenced by a high-risk climate for hail, strong winds, heavy snow loads, and intense UV radiation. Consequently, the top service providers are those with specialized expertise in storm damage restoration, durable material installation (like Class 4 impact-resistant shingles and metal roofs), and navigating complex insurance claims. Due to its small size, Masonville is primarily serviced by established roofing contractors from nearby larger cities like Loveland and Fort Collins.

1What is the typical cost range for a full roof replacement on a single-family home in Masonville?

In Masonville and the surrounding Northern Colorado area, a full asphalt shingle roof replacement for an average-sized home (2,000-2,500 sq ft) typically ranges from $12,000 to $25,000. The final cost is highly dependent on the roof's pitch and complexity, the quality of materials chosen, and the extent of any underlying decking damage discovered. Colorado's high-altitude sun and temperature swings make investing in higher-quality, impact-resistant shingles a wise long-term decision for durability.

2When is the best time of year to schedule a roof replacement in Masonville, considering the local climate?

The ideal window for roofing in Masonville is typically from late spring through early fall (May to October). This period offers the most consistent dry weather, which is crucial for proper installation and material adhesion. Winters can bring snow and ice, while our spring is known for unpredictable wind and hail storms that can delay projects. Scheduling early in this window is advised, as reputable local roofers book up quickly.

3Are there specific local building codes or HOA requirements in Masonville I need to be aware of for a new roof?

Yes, you must consider both. All roofing work in Masonville must comply with the Larimer County Building Code, which adopts the International Residential Code (IRC) with amendments for Colorado's snow loads. Additionally, many neighborhoods in Masonville have Covenants (CC&Rs) or an HOA that may regulate material types (e.g., requiring dimensional shingles), colors, and even the approval process. Always check with your HOA and ensure your contractor pulls the proper county permits.

5How does Colorado's hail risk impact my roofing material choices and insurance in Masonville?

Masonville sits in a region with a moderate-to-high risk of hail, which is the leading cause of roof damage here. We strongly recommend choosing impact-resistant shingles rated Class 3 or 4 (UL 2218 or FM 4473), as they can better withstand hail and may qualify you for a discount on your homeowner's insurance premium. After any significant hail storm, have a reputable local roofer perform a free inspection, as damage can be subtle but lead to leaks over time.
